Output f8528bab6f016df75125998a1a63a0e5d5763f5ffd5064100a209426ec43b694:22

value
99800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c84c1f2876f507cf0834936d433896e4d7a7768a OP_EQUALVERIFY OP_CHECKSIG
address
LdV2bcEcwgVSY6cbVdyCEU5AJksYu8HTan
transaction
f8528bab6f016df75125998a1a63a0e5d5763f5ffd5064100a209426ec43b694
spent
true